Career path

Career Role in Global Trade Law Enforcement (UK) Description
Trade Compliance Officer Ensures adherence to international trade regulations, minimizing legal and financial risks for businesses. Key skills include import/export regulations, customs procedures, and sanctions compliance.
Customs Investigator Investigates suspected customs violations, including smuggling and fraud. Requires strong investigative skills, knowledge of trade laws, and experience in evidence gathering and analysis.
International Trade Lawyer Provides legal counsel to businesses and government agencies on international trade matters, including dispute resolution and policy advice. Expertise in WTO law, trade agreements, and sanctions is essential.
Trade Policy Analyst Analyzes trade policies and their impact on businesses and the economy. Strong analytical, research and communication skills are necessary, along with knowledge of international trade agreements and economic principles.
